Issue 4682: Section 8.4, page 34 (spem-ftf) Source: France Telecom R&D (Mr. Mariano Belaunde, mariano.belaunde@orange-ftgroup.com) Nature: Uncategorized Issue Severity: Summary: "A ProcessRole is responsisble for..." Too complex and unclear. Why not an explicit "responsibleFor" relationship in the MM? This will minimize the size of XMI files generated from SPEM. Resolution: Accept. Revised Text: Add an association to figure 7-1 as follows: In 7.4 ProcessPerformer and ProcessRole:Associations bullet 2, delete "; this is modeled by creating M1-level associations between the ProcessRole and the relevant WorkProducts". In 7.1 WorkProduct and InformationElement:Associations, add a new bullet: A WorkProduct may be associated with a responsibleRole, representing the role that is formally responsible for the production of this WorkProduct. On page 11-7, before the paragraph referring to WorkDefinition::goal, insert a new paragraph as follows: WorkProduct::responsibleRole. This is not represented directly in the profile. Instead, in an application of the profile, this would be modeled by creating M1-level associations between the ProcessRole and the relevant WorkProducts.
